MAX17601ATA+T Details

  • Manufacturer Part Number:

    MAX17601ATA+T

  • Brand Name:

    Analog Devices Inc

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Part Package Code:

    8-LFCSP-3X3X0.75

  • Package Description:

    TDFN-8

  • Pin Count:

    8

  • Manufacturer Package Code:

    8-LFCSP-3X3X0.75

  • Country Of Origin:

    Japan, Mainland China, Malaysia, Philippines, Singapore, South Korea, Taiwan, Thailand, USA

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.39.00.60

  • Date Of Intro:

    2012-01-20

  • Manufacturer:

    Analog Devices Inc

  • YTEOL:

    10

  • High Side Driver:

    YES

  • Input Characteristics:

    SCHMITT TRIGGER

  • Interface IC Type:

    BUFFER OR INVERTER BASED MOSFET DRIVER

  • JESD-30 Code:

    S-PDSO-N8

  • JESD-609 Code:

    e3

  • Length:

    3 mm

  • Moisture Sensitivity Level:

    1

  • Number of Functions:

    2

  • Number of Terminals:

    8

  • Operating Temperature-Max:

    125 °C

  • Operating Temperature-Min:

    -40 °C

  • Output Peak Current Limit-Nom:

    4 A

  • Output Polarity:

    TRUE

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Code:

    HVSON

  • Package Equivalence Code:

    SOLCC8,.12,25

  • Package Shape:

    SQUARE

  • Package Style:

    SMALL OUTLINE, HEAT SINK/SLUG, VERY THIN PROFILE

  • Peak Reflow Temperature (Cel):

    260

  • Seated Height-Max:

    0.8 mm

  • Supply Current-Max:

    18 mA

  • Supply Voltage-Max:

    14 V

  • Supply Voltage-Min:

    4 V

  • Supply Voltage-Nom:

    12 V

  • Surface Mount:

    YES

  • Technology:

    BICMOS

  • Terminal Finish:

    Matte Tin (Sn) - annealed

  • Terminal Form:

    NO LEAD

  • Terminal Pitch:

    0.65 mm

  • Terminal Position:

    DUAL

  • Time@Peak Reflow Temperature-Max (s):

    30

  • Turn-off Time:

    0.012 µs

  • Turn-on Time:

    0.012 µs

  • Width:

    3 mm

About Analog Devices

Analog Devices Inc. is a global leader in the design and manufacturing of analog, mixed-signal, and digital signal processing integrated circuits and software solutions for the industrial, automotive, healthcare, communications industries. Analog Devices serves a diverse range of markets including industrial, automotive, healthcare, energy, aerospace, defense, and consumer electronics industries. Analog Devices’ product portfolio includes a wide range of ICs, modules, and subsystems.
